Wǔlín Buddhist Seminary: Wǔlín fóxué yuàn 武林佛學院

A short-lived Buddhist seminary located in Hángzhōu 杭州

A Buddhist Seminary 佛學院 established by Yǎnpéi 演培 and Miàoqīn 妙欽 under the direction of Tàixū 太虛 in 1946. The first class numbered more than 30 students. After one semester, Huìjué 會覺 came to act as principal, and Jùzàn 巨贊 as vice-principal.

The Seminary shut down in 1948 because of the civil war.
